Buenos Aires (Argentina), Mar 17 (LaPresse/AP) – Argentina star Lionel Messi will miss the upcoming 2026 World Cup qualifying fixtures against Uruguay and Brazil. The ‘Pulce’ has not been included in the squad list by coach Lionel Scaloni. According to the Argentine press, the player is suffering from a left thigh problem felt yesterday during Inter Miami's victory against Atlanta United in the Mls championship (2-1), however the Argentine federation did not specify the reasons for his absence. The list includes seven players who play in Italy. They are Lautaro Martinez (Inter), Leandro Paredes (Roma), Nico Gonzalez (Juventus), Maximo Perrone and Nico Paz (Como), Nicolas Dominguez and Santiago Castro (Bologna).
